Sé que hay una opción para reemplazar el símbolo del sistema con Powershell en el menú de Windows+X, realmente me gustaría reemplazarlo con Git Bash.
Miré alrededor del registro pero nada me llamó la atención.
Estaría bien para mí reemplazar el ejecutable cmd de alguna manera... Lo intenté sin mucho éxito (rompí la funcionalidad de aviso o enfrenté varios obstáculos aparentemente relacionados con la seguridad).
Respuesta1
Para el menú Win+X, Microsoft decidió utilizar un enfoque completamente nuevo. No encontrarás nada en el registro (aparte de la clave que modifica el cmd a powershell...), pero aún así es personalizable.
Básicamente los enlaces se almacenan %LocalAppData%Microsoft\Windows\WinX
pero por alguna razón no son enlaces normales, por lo que la modificación no es del todo trivial. Aquí solo se reconocen los enlaces a los que se les ha agregado un hash. Hayuna herramientaque modifica cualquier archivo lnk para que sea reconocido en esta carpeta (puede encontrar una guía paso a paso sobre cómo usarloaquí.)
Alternativamente también existe una herramienta que permite la modificación directa del menú Win+X.encontrado aquí. Probablemente se base en la misma idea. Ambos fueron desarrollados para Windows 8, pero deberían funcionar también en Windows 10.
Respuesta2
Supongo que a Microsoft no le gusta la idea de utilizar suinternotecla de acceso rápido global para iniciar algunostercero tercerocaparazón. Por lo tanto, puede que sólo haya soluciones alternativas.
IntentarAutoHotkey. Creo que puedes vincular cualquier tecla de acceso rápido para iniciar tu shell.
Escriba una aplicación de enlace, que inserte su código en el proceso explorer.exe y ejecute bash.exe en lugar de cmd.exe. Groseramente y mucha codificación...
Crear acceso directo en el escritorio. Configure la tecla de acceso rápido deseada. No puedes usar Win+X allí.
Y dale una oportunidad aConEmu. Puedes usarlo en "modo Quake" o expandirlo automáticamente al área de estado de la barra de tareas. También puedesustituir el terminal predeterminado de Windows.